The Technical Skills You'll Learn in Plumbing Training
Plumbing modern technology 101, the first training course, outlines the fundamental of the plumbing profession. The goal of this initial course is to show students the fundamentals of the profession or to familiarize house owners with some diy techniques.
Much of the issues attended to in this initial of the plumbing courses are those that will certainly show up nearly everyday in a plumbing professionals work life. These include the system that supplies a property or business building with water, soldering, vents as well as drains pipes, installation of plumbing associated components and also repair work of the exact same.
The specifics of the training course include a take a look at fundamental plumbing safety and security tips as well as orientation with the lingo and basic terms of the plumbing profession. Soldering is an integral part of this plumbing course too.
After this lesson each trainee need to have the ability to select the suitable soldering materials, tidy the steels to obtain them ready for soldering, prepare the joint and solder a tubing connection the appropriate and also secure way.
Water service is part of this fundamental program materials as well as training. Trainees discover the format of a residence or business cellar, the ins and outs of selecting the right materials and the proper place of the necessary equipment.
Students learn to install a drain, as well as a ventilation and also waste system. They additionally learn more about mounting components in these on-line plumbing training courses.

Plumbing Courses: The Journey to Becoming a Plumber


When your sink, shower, or toilet breaks, you call a plumber to come fix it. But a plumber’s job is not only to fix broken pipes. They install them as well, making sure your sink, bathtub, toilet, and washing machine are all functioning. If you have considered entering this career field, then follow this guide to see what type of plumbing courses you could take.



To become a plumber, you must first take a training course that will prepare you for your career.


Types of Plumbing Courses


There are three main types of plumbing courses: apprenticeships, community college programs, and online classes.



On your journey to becoming a plumber, you will attend a variety of courses to learn the essentials about the plumbing industry. During this training, you will learn how to assess a plumbing issue, how to fix it by installing the necessary hardware, and much more.



These courses are offered either on-campus or online. Let’s take a look at the three main types of plumbing courses you can pursue, and some specific examples.


Community College Plumbing Courses



Community colleges are a great place to study a vocational skill like plumbing. Let’s look at one community college, Cuyahoga County Community College, Tri-C, and the courses that it offers. These classes are similar to what you will find at other community college plumbing programs nationwide.



Electricity for Plumbers


Plumbers must also learn basic fundamentals of electricity because they work in close proximity to electrical outlets and with electrical plumbing systems. In this course, you will learn the following:


  • Electrical safety


  • Troubleshooting exercises


  • Motors


  • Transformers


  • Direct and alternating currents
